All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/pa/somerset/ _______________________________________________ BYERS Harry Willard Byers, 74, Monroeville, died Oct. 28, 1995, at his home. Born June 25, 1921, in Sand Patch, son of the late Harry and Carolina Elizabeth (Habel) Byers. Survived by widow, Estella (Staub), and 3 sons: Michael, Baltimore, and William and Thomas, both of Monroeville. Also survived by these brothers and sisters: Una Lichty and Doris Clapper, both of Meyersdale; Louise Phillippi and Ferne Kinter, both of Rockwood; and Blaine and John, both of Las Cruces, N.M. Professional engineer with a BS degree in engineering from the University of Pittsburgh. Worked for Swindell and Dressler and Koppers of Pittsburgh and the Mannesmann Demag Corp., Pittsburgh. Member of Amity United Church of Christ and Charles E. Kelly American Legion Post 112, and the B.P.O.E. Elks Lodge, Meyersdale.
